Gordejuela House is undoubtedly one of the most impressive buildings that can be seen in the vicinity of Puerto de la Cruz. It can be enjoyed when making a path that connects one end of the town with the municipality of Los Realejos along the coast.
What is the Gordejuela House and what was its role?
Gordejuela House is a five-storey building that is currently abandoned on the north coast of Tenerife. It was built at the beginning of the 20th century and housed the first steam engine of the island.
Thanks to it, people could use the spring waters of the area, transport them and thus use them for the banana plantation of the Orotava Valley.
As you can see, the orography in this part of the island is very steep, and building a place like that in 1903 at the foot of a vertical cliff was quite a feat.
Where can you enjoy this impressive building?
If you want to appreciate as much as possible all the details of the Gordejuela House, you can take the path that goes from El Burgado Street, after finishing the route through the Loro Parque Avenue, to San Pedro Viewpoint in Los Realejos, passing through the protected area of La Rambla de Castro where there is a large palm grove and the Casona de los Castro.
It is a simple and well-conditioned path that you can walk in an hour and a half or two hours (depending on the speed at which you make the road and the time you spend taking photos).
You will find Gordejuela House approximately half way, where you can see the ruins of this impressive abandoned building from the top.
There is a fork that allows you to descend a little further towards Gordejuela House, but whose access is currently closed at a certain point as a precautionary measure.
Abandoned buildings in Tenerife
Gordejuela House is one of the most spectacular abandoned buildings in Tenerife, along with the Sanatorium of Abades in the south of the island, which was designed to house leprosy patients at the time (although it was not used for that purpose) and the Traffic Light of Igueste, in Igueste de San Andrés, whose path will be also analyzed in depth in another post.
